Output e56920d26c03432e884c34d56b6cb147b91119b708922f1964e5c079455fcbe3:6

value
2095812100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4ed779fa9d8afbcb78872f714c4bdf14bd41142 OP_EQUAL
address
MUmcmgbCKXbzPNpTLTb7Vyc5hNwN6CZbRb
transaction
e56920d26c03432e884c34d56b6cb147b91119b708922f1964e5c079455fcbe3
spent
true